CentOS 命令行下衔接加密形式为 WPA/WPA2ITeye - 威尼斯人

CentOS 命令行下衔接加密形式为 WPA/WPA2ITeye

2019年03月13日10时31分30秒 | 作者: 芷容 | 标签: 加密,咱们,装备 | 浏览: 2943

记录了 CentOS 最小化装置后怎么装备和衔接无线网络,其时的状况是路由器运用的WEP加密方法,所以设置暗码的时分能够直接运用明文暗码。后来当把路由器的加密形式设置为 WPA/WPA2-PSK的时分,发现现已无法衔接无线网络了,原因是当运用 WPA/WPA2-PSK 加密形式之后客户端不能直接发送明文暗码,而是要运用加密之后的暗码,已然咱们知道了原因咱们该怎么做呢?
首要咱们要装置一个帮咱们生成加密暗码并装备网卡的工具包 wpa_supplicant

yum install -y wpa_supplicant

 
然后找到咱们路由的 ESSID,比方我是 long,然后生成暗码装备文件,

 

 

wpa_passphrase long my password

 它会输出如下内容

 

 

network={
 ssid="long"
 #psk="my password"
 psk=350fb537ccec9b6de427eb4a43b7e02ae0492a59ce0a095ac6b527aef2c40f94
}

 

 

将输入的内容追加到 /etc/wpa_supplicant/wpa_supplicant.conf
或许直接履行

 

wpa_passphrase long my password /etc/wpa_supplicant/wpa_supplicant.conf

 

 

再把其间 ssid= 和 psk= 加入到wlan0 的装备文件,或履行一下指令

 

wpa_passphrase long my password | grep -v {\|} /etc/sysconfig/network-scripts/ifcfg-wlan0
echo WPA=yes /etc/sysconfig/network-scripts/ifcfg-wlan0

 我的装备文件内容如下:

 

 

DEVICE=wlan0
TYPE=Ethernet
ONBOOT=yes
NM_CONTROLLED=yes
BOOTPROTO=static
IPADDR=192.168.1.5
NETMASK=255.255.255.0
GATEWAY=192.168.1.1
WPA=yes
SSID="long"
PSK=350fb537ccec9b6de427eb4a43b7e02ae0492a59ce0a095ac6b527aef2c40f94

 然后,咱们能够发动网络设备

 

 

ifup wlan0

 

 

再发动 wpa_supplicant

 

 

wpa_supplicant -iwlan0 -B -c /etc/wpa_supplicant/wpa_supplicant.conf

 

 

咱们需求随机发动的话,加入到 /etc/rc.local

cat /etc/rc.local EOF
wpa_supplicant -iwlan0 -B -c /etc/wpa_supplicant/wpa_supplicant.conf

 

 

 

 

 

 

以上是来自网上的一篇文章

 

我的路由器的装备信息:

 

 无线的加密设置

/etc/sysconfig/network-scripts/ifcfg-wlan0文件的内容:

 

DEVICE=wlan0
HWADDR=84:A6:C8:E6:37:6E
TYPE=Ethernet
UUID=2393dafa-31ff-4a66-b00d-51af7ebfb9c1
ONBOOT=yes
NM_CONTROLLED=yes
BOOTPROTO=dhcp
WPA=yes
SSID="junjin.mai"
PSK=742af11ddda680defba6e1c2b20ea04529f20edf7972f869d613c651d9cb9335

 
 /etc/wpa_supplicant/wpa_supplicant.conf文件的内容

ctrl_interface=/var/run/wpa_supplicant
ctrl_interface_group=wheel
network={
 ssid="junjin.mai"
 proto=WPA2 
 key_mgmt=WPA-PSK #请不管你是运用WPA-PSK,WPA2-PSK,都请在这儿输入 WPA-PSK。这在wpa_supplicant看来WPA-PSK,WPA2-PSK都是 WPA-PSK,改成WPA2-PSK,它会不认识
 pairwise=CCMP 
 #psk="junjin.mai123;"
 psk=742af11ddda680defba6e1c2b20ea04529f20edf7972f869d613c651d9cb9335

 /etc/rc.local文件的内容

 

#!/bin/sh
# This script will be executed *after* all the other init scripts.
# You can put your own initialization stuff in here if you dont
# want to do the full Sys V style init stuff.
touch /var/lock/subsys/local
wpa_supplicant -iwlan0 -B -c /etc/wpa_supplicant/wpa_supplicant.conf
ifup wlan0

 

版权声明
本文来源于网络,版权归原作者所有,其内容与观点不代表威尼斯人立场。转载文章仅为传播更有价值的信息,如采编人员采编有误或者版权原因,请与我们联系,我们核实后立即修改或删除。

猜您喜欢的文章